Monitor Cabling
Monitors are supported for Analog Audio, Digital Audio, Analog Video,
and Digital Video modules. Port and Time Code modules do not have
monitor outputs. The physical configuration of the Concerto frame will
determine how many and what type of monitoring devices can be con-
nected.
Analog Video Monitoring
Analog Video modules have one backplane, use internal bussing for
monitor outputs, and cannot be combined with any other module type. All
outputs are available to all Analog Video modules in the same configured
matrix. Each backplane has a single BNC
Mon Out
, so the number of modules
in the configured matrix will determine the number of Mon Out connec-
tors. A 32x32 configured matrix will have outputs 1-32 available to a single
Mon Out
BNC connector. A 64x64 configured matrix will have outputs 1-64
available to two
Mon Out
BNC connectors. Both outputs are the same and
two monitoring devices can display the same Video signal. The
Mon In
con-

Digital Video Monitoring
There are two types of Digital Video modules a SD Digital Video and a HD
Digital Video. Each of the two modules has its own BNC backplane. These
modules use external loop cabling for monitor outputs and the two types
of Digital Video can be combined into a configured matrix.
CAUTION The maximum number of HD modules that can be in a 7 RU Concerto frame
is three in which case the fourth slot has to remain empty. If two HD modules
are used then the other two slots can be loaded with any of the non HD mod-
ules.
The preferred hierarchy between 3Gb/s, SD and HD Video modules in the
same configured matrix is to place the SD modules before the HD and 3Gb/
s modules. For example, if you have a frame with two SD modules and two
HD modules, place the SD modules in slots 1 and 2, and the HD modules
in slots 3 and 4. Then all the SD video signals (outputs 1-64) will be routed
to the HD modules (outputs 65-128) making all outputs available to the
Mon
Out
BNC connector on the backplane in slot 4. HD signals (1.485 Gbps) can
only be routed through HD modules, so if the HD module is before a SD
module it will break the chain.
